1. 程式人生 > >IDEA Method definition shorthands are not supported by current JavaScript version

IDEA Method definition shorthands are not supported by current JavaScript version

sentinel-dashboard前端用到了AngularJS v1.4.8,在IDEA裡修改js,觸發js驗證時有一些js檔案會出現紅色波浪線。
在程式碼行裡滑鼠一上去提示資訊:Method definition shorthands are not supported by current JavaScript version

雖然不執行工程編譯、啟動執行,但像java檔案有問題一樣的紅色波浪線看著不清爽。

看描述是JavaScript版本某些定義和寫法不支援。

解決方法:

File->Settings->Languages & Frameworks->JavaScript
JavaScript language version選擇ECMAScript 6,儲存設定等IDEA重新Index即可。


參考:

https://blog.csdn.net/WYpersist/article/details/80509043